In this review of the Libin Women's Hiking Pants the bottom line is simple: these are a solid choice for hikers and travelers who want lightweight, breathable pants with useful storage and sun protection. The reviewer found the fabric exceptionally thin and quick drying, which keeps heat and moisture under control on warm days, while the UPF 50+ treatment and light water resistance add practical protection for long hours outdoors. Fit runs slightly generous for some sizes, so consider that when choosing between petite, regular, and tall options.
Key Features
- Super lightweight fabric: The thin, low-weight material helps keep you cool and reduces bulk during long hikes or travel days.
- Quick dry and water resistant: Moisture wicks away and light splashes bead up, so pants dry fast after perspiration or brief rain.
- UPF 50+ protection: Integrated UV treatment shields exposed legs from sun during extended outdoor use.
- Zippered storage: Five zipper pockets, including two thigh pockets and a rear pocket, keep essentials secure and organized on the trail.
- Adjustable fit points: An elastic waistband with drawstring plus adjustable hem drawcords let you fine tune fit and pant length over boots.
Who It's For
The Libin hiking pants suit active women who prioritize lightweight, breathable clothing for day hikes, travel, walking, or casual outdoor work. They are especially useful for those who want secure zip pockets and sun protection without heavy fabric bulk.
Shoppers looking for heavy insulation, strong four-way stretch for athletic climbing, or fully waterproof technical shell pants should look elsewhere. Also, because the fabric has only a little elasticity, users who need a lot of stretch for high-mobility sports may prefer a different style.

Specifications
| Brand | Libin |
| Style | Women's hiking cargo pants |
| Fabric weight | Super lightweight, thin quick dry material |
| Sun protection | UPF 50+ |
| Pockets | 5 zippered pockets (2 front, 2 thigh, 1 rear) |
| Waist | Elastic waistband with adjustable drawstring |
| Hem | Adjustable drawcord at bottom hem |

Frequently Asked Questions
Are these pants good for tall women?
Yes, the pants come in petite, regular and tall lengths, and several reviewers noted the tall option works well for taller figures.
Do the pockets stay closed during activity?
Yes, the five pockets use zippers and customers reported the zippers are smooth and keep items secure during movement.
Are they waterproof?
No, they are water resistant and fend off light moisture, but they are not fully waterproof for heavy rain.
